Start the career as Linux Administrator – What is really required

In this article we will talk about the how one can start the career as Linux administrator. A Linux admin, or Linux system administrator, is an IT professional who manages the functionality of a Linux system. Similar to Windows, Linux is an operating system that connects the internal hardware in electronics, including phones and computers. Administrators answer technical questions about how Linux works and collaborate with other technology experts, such as software developers. One may also choose to specialize in Cloud Computing & Automation.

Probable Preparatory Steps

  • Get a Bachelor’s degree which can be the minimum education requirement. One can also have a Master’s but that should not be a compulsion. You can chose any of the below Streams
    • Computer science
    • Information technology
    • Information science
    • Software Engineering
    • Telecommunications

Although now a days majoring in the related field is not a bar and we seen people from various backgrounds have been efficiently contributing to the technology field.

  • Training Courses : Training courses can offer a strong foundation about Linux, which you can continue to expand upon as you become more proficient. Starting with the basics of the systems they can even take you to even writing kernel or script. The most reputable Linux Administration courses is available by the Red Hat Red Hat System Administration I
  • Hands on – When you practice installing Linux, you can learn to configure the internal function of the hardware firsthand, which can help you become a competent Linux administrator. You can look various online guides and blogs that offer step-by-step guides to installing Linux on a device. Once you install the system, practice performing various task using the Linux commands. Refer our previous blog post How to Install Rocky Linux 8
  • Certifications : Once you are drowned in handling the Linux based system and you are clear of the fundamentals of the system, research Linux certifications to find one that’s best for you Yet again Red Hat still rules the Certification arena in the Linux world . Make sure to add your certification to your resume. You can go for Red Hat Certified System Administrator (RHCSA) exam as the first step into the certifications.

Duties of a Linux Admin

  • Responsible for company’s Linux Infra – Linux installation, management, and troubleshooting
  • Develop, monitor and maintain features for the infrastructure, platform, and applications
  • Maintain and create tools for the Linux environment and the users
  • Keep internet requests inclusive to MySQL, Apache, PHP, DNS & other applications
  • Managing network servers
  • Analyze error logs and fixing them together with the support team
  • Planning projects to restore smooth operation in event of major disruption
  • Ensure the functionality of everyday applications (e-mail system and internal communication)
  • Run backups of data regularly and design new stored procedures
  • Maintaining system security by identifying vulnerable areas and providing protections
  • Install the required systems and security tools to provide protection
  • Provide technical assistance when needed

Skills required by the Linux Admin

  • Problem Solving Skills – Linux administrators need to troubleshoot and report bugs. They also process user concerns, which can help them establish a pattern in network issues and install a system to prevent the issues from recurring.
  • Communication : This role demands patience and active listening when they communicate with other people in their organizations. They work closely with data network engineers and developers to answer technical questions about the operating system. Linux administrators may also need to educate other testers & developers in case of any issues being brought up by the depending team members.
  • Technical Skills – As a Linux Admins he should be technically strong with certain areas –
    • Linux file systems: Knowing what systems Linux supports can help administrators properly configure the network.
    • File system hierarchy: The Linux system has a unique format, and administrators are responsible for knowing what location to store certain files.
    • Command lines: Administrators can execute different instructions within the system, such as copying and removing files or adding user accounts.
    • Disaster recovery: Operators can back up and restore files in Linux and reboot the system to prevent the loss of sensitive information.
    • Network security and firewalls: Administrators can establish security protocols in the Linux system and install functions to notify them of problems.

So what are you waiting for – Get on to the Linux system with your hands on and once you are confident enough apply to any job posting Websites. Before you apply, tailor your resume to the specific role and include details about your certification and technical abilities in your cover letter.

Leave a comment